Sandrol Population - Solan, Himachal Pradesh

Sandrol is a small village located in Solan Tehsil of Solan district, Himachal Pradesh with total 18 families residing. The Sandrol village has population of 96 of which 51 are males while 45 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sandrol village population of children with age 0-6 is 10 which makes up 10.42 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sandrol village is 882 which is lower than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Sandrol as per census is 429, lower than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.

Sandrol village has lower liter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Sandrol village was 77.91 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Sandrol Male literacy stands at 81.82 % while female literacy rate was 73.81 %.
